fix(frontend): append UTC offset to Instant date parameters in consumption dashboard
The consumption dashboard sent dates like '2026-06-24T00:00:00' without timezone offset, which Spring could not parse into java.time.Instant. Append 'Z' suffix to produce valid ISO-8601 UTC timestamps.
